Output 121c6578396e237216f2526e8ffa150374a1e55add52acff13501ed58907de76:0

value
17596146
script pubkey
OP_0 OP_PUSHBYTES_20 ccf263a715e19f0f43eed506406db88d9c6baf5d
address
bc1qenex8fc4ux0s7slw65ryqmdc3kwxht6ard4pdq
transaction
121c6578396e237216f2526e8ffa150374a1e55add52acff13501ed58907de76